Wolves Complete Weekend Sweep with Win Over Warriors

Aberdeen, S.D. A series of key plays helped the Northern State University women's basketball team secure an 85-73 victory over Winona State, concluding the I Hate Winter weekend. Five Wolves scored in double digits, with Michaela Jewett and Madelyn Bragg leading the way, contributing 25 and 20 points, respectively.
 
THE QUICK DETAILS
Final Score: NSU 85, WSU 73
Records: NSU 13-7 (NSIC 10-4), WSU 8-12 (NSIC 4-10)
Attendance: 2611
 
HOW IT HAPPENED
  • Northern State recorded 18 points in the first quarter, 27 in the second, 20 in the third, and 20 in the fourth
  • The Wolves scored 26 points in the paint, 12 points off the bench, 10 second-chance points, and 7 points off turnovers
  • NSU shot 50.0% from the field, 38.5% from beyond the arc, and 83.3% from the free-throw line
  • Michaela Jewett led the team with 25 points, 12 rebounds, and six assists, shooting 55.6% from the field
  • Madelyn Bragg added 20 points, 6 rebounds, and 5 blocks, shooting 60.0% from the floor
  • Alayna Benike contributed 12 points, 4 rebounds, 2 assists, and 1 block
  • Rianna Fillipi and Izzy Moore both scored 10 points and grabbed 6 rebounds. Fillipi also recorded 6 assists
